WebHotel and motel fires occurred mainly in the evening hours, peaking from 6 to 9 p.m. (19 percent). ĵ. Cooking was the leading cause of hotel and motel fires (55 percent). Almost all hotel and motel cooking fires were small, confined fires (95 percent). ĵ. In 22 percent of nonconfined hotel and motel fires, the fires extended beyond the room ...
